The topic of gas is difficult, but it is a fact that Russian interests in Bulgaria have always been strong, but this does not mean that we have served them. You see a Germany that is much more dependent on Russian gas than Bulgaria.
This was stated before the NOVA Constitutional Court and former Prime Minister of the country Filip Dimitrov (1991-1992).
According to him, Bulgaria has done the right thing by starting to look for sources of gas from other places other than Russia.
Any distancing from Russian influence is easier because it always ends up being bad for us in the last 150 years. Any attempts at permanent ties with Russia are extremely harmful, according to Dimitrov.
Regarding the idea of a presidential republic, the constitutionalist said that “many people are trying to solve the problems with the Constitution”. And he recalled that in order to change the format of government, a Great National Assembly is needed, which, according to him, will not happen.
Each government is dependent on the parliament in the French semi-presidential regime. That is, nothing will change the picture with this. The problem with us is the fragmentation of the parties and the unfitness of the parliament. When leaders don’t happen, they just don’t happen, he says.
Philip explained that the Bulgarian president, according to the Constitution, has the opportunity to strike a balance in critical moments for the country – a privilege that other heads of state in Europe do not have.
